| Title | Burrow's Monaural Stethoscope |
| Date | 1800-1899 |
| Description | This is a monaural stethoscope of the Burrow's type. It is composed of a narrow wooden body that flares out to the earpiece. The diaphragm is almost flat, the base is ever so slightly concave and with a rubber ring around the circumference. This is characteristic for the Burrow's type stethoscope, which could also acted as a percussor. |
